About New York Magazine

What’s included in the app:
- It’s a Pleasure: Our app is the most enjoyable way to read us on your iPhone — for one thing, there are fewer log-ins.
- Switch Between Sites With Ease: Now you can conveniently toggle between the quick takes, deep dives, and long reads across Vulture, the Cut, Intelligencer, Curbed, Grub Street, and the Strategist. Seamlessly switch between your favorite sites or set the home page to your go-to.
- Spend Time With Our Editors’ Picks: They’ll be regularly highlighting the stories across New York that they think are worth a read in our new “Great Stories” section.
- Be the First to Know What Everyone’s Talking About: With notifications and a new “Collections” section, both exclusive to the app, you’ll get first access to the most-talked-about stories across New York.
- Join the Conversation: Comment on articles and read past discussions on your favorite stories.
- Save Stories to Enjoy Later: Find articles in the “Saved for Later” section of your account to read them anytime.
